Arabica vs. Robusta: Understanding the Difference
Arabica and Robusta are the two main species of coffee beans. Arabica beans are known for their delicate flavors, pleasant acidity, and nuanced aromas. They are often associated with specialty coffees and are a popular choice among coffee connoisseurs. On the other hand, Robusta beans are bolder and more bitter, with a higher caffeine content. They are commonly used in blends and instant coffees.
When selecting coffee beans, consider your personal taste preferences and the flavor profile you desire in your cup of coffee. Experiment with different varieties and origins to discover your perfect brew.
Mastering Brewing Techniques
Once you have chosen the right beans, it's time to master the art of coffee brewing. There are various brewing methods available, each with its unique characteristics and flavor profiles. Here are a few popular brewing techniques to explore:
1. Drip Brewing: The Classic Approach
Drip brewing, also known as pour-over brewing, is a classic and widely-used method for making coffee. It involves pouring hot water over a filter containing ground coffee beans, allowing the water to slowly drip through and extract the flavors. This method allows for control over the brewing time and intensity of the coffee.
2. French Press: Full-Bodied and Rich
The French press method is renowned for its ability to produce full-bodied and rich coffee. It involves steeping ground coffee in hot water and then pressing a plunger to separate the coffee grounds from the liquid. This method allows the natural oils and flavors of the coffee to remain intact, resulting in a more robust cup of joe.
3. Espresso: Bold and Concentrated
Espresso brewing is the foundation of various coffee-based beverages, such as lattes, cappuccinos, and macchiatos. It involves forcing hot water through finely ground coffee under high pressure, resulting in a concentrated and intense shot of espresso. This brewing method requires a specialized espresso machine but offers unparalleled versatility in creating a wide range of coffee drinks.
Perfecting the Coffee-to-Water Ratio
Achieving the ideal coffee-to-water ratio is essential for brewing a balanced and flavorful cup of coffee. The general rule of thumb is to use a ratio of 1:16, meaning 1 gram of coffee for every 16 grams of water. However, personal preferences may vary, and experimenting with different ratios can help you find the perfect balance for your taste buds.
Understanding Coffee Grinding
Coffee grinding plays a crucial role in the overall taste and quality of your coffee. The grind size determines the rate of extraction during brewing, affecting factors like flavor strength and aroma. Different brewing methods require specific grind sizes to achieve optimal results.
Coarse Grind: French Press
For French press brewing, a coarse grind is recommended. The larger coffee grounds allow for a slower extraction process, resulting in a full-bodied and flavorful cup of coffee.
Medium Grind: Drip Brewing
Drip brewing methods, such as pour-over or automatic coffee makers, require a medium grind. This grind size allows for a balanced extraction, producing a clean and well-rounded cup of coffee.
Fine Grind: Espresso
Espresso brewing calls for a fine grind to ensure proper extraction within a short brewing time. The finer particles enable efficient water flow through the coffee grounds, resulting in a concentrated and bold shot of espresso.
